Yes, RIIM Pune offers good placements to its students. The key highlights of RIIM Pune placements 2024 are presented below:

Particulars

PGDM Placement Statistics (2024)

the highest package

INR 27 LPA

Average package

INR 7.5 LPA

Total offers

1500+

On-campus recruiters

600+

The domain-wise the highest package offered during RIIM Pune PGDM placements 2024 is presented below:

Domains

the highest Package (2024)

Marketing

INR 27 LPA

Finance

INR 24 LPA

Human Resource

INR 12 LPA

Agri Business

INR 10 LPA

The overall the highest package offered during RIIM Pune PGDM placements 2024 is presented below:

Particulars

PGDM Placement Statistics (2024)

the highest package

INR 27 LPA

The sector-wise recruiters visited during RIIM Pune PGDM placements 2024 is presented below:

Sectors  

Recruiters (PGDM batch 2024)

IT / ITES

23%

Research / Analytics

16%

BFSI / Fintech

13%

FMCG

11%

Real Estate

9%

Logistics

5%

Media / E-Commerce

4%

Consulting

4%

Retail

4%

Healthcare

4%

Hospitality and Tourism

4%

Manufacturing and Automobile

3%
